返回

Build 工具 Gradle 介紹

Build 工具 Gradle 介紹

Gradle 是以 Apache Ant 與 Apache Maven 為基底的開源自動化建構工具,使用 Groovy 語言編寫 Build 腳本。

Build工具Gradle介紹

自動化建構工具可幫忙處理開發過程中的瑣事,舉凡編譯、打包、測試、建模 ...等,而 Gradle 結合了 Ant 的強大功能與 Maven 套裝管理的概念,並支援 Maven、Ivy Repository,解決掉重覆依賴導致專案過於龐大管理不易的問題。

且相較於 XML 繁瑣的配置,Groovy 的 DSL(Domain-Specific Languages)增加了可讀性與靈活性,讓開發者能更直覺的撰寫期望的程式。

  • 搭配多種語言

除了 Java 外,還可運用於 C++、Python ...等。

  • 豐富的 API 與 Plugins

Gradle 提供了豐富的 API 與 Plugins,開發者能享受到從頭到尾的自動化功能。

  • IDE 支援

除了 Eclipse 外,亦可在 Android Studio、IDEA、NetBeans 使用。

Liferay 自 DXP(7.0)起,Liferay IDE 開發Plugin 全面支援 Gradle Build,以新架構提供開發者更強大的開發系統環境。


內容關鍵字 內容關鍵字